Note: you can keep certain Florida shark species, but most sharks are off-limits for harvesting. These sharks have to be released. But don't worry about shark identification. Your Captain will assist you.
Sharks can be found in offshore and inshore waters. Deep waters are home to adult sharks, while shallows are a playground for juveniles and pups.
There are many options for bait. Mullet, Ladyfish, Bonita, and Blue Runner would be the ideal bait for shark fishing. Fishing charters prepare the best bait depending on the targeted shark species.

Tarpon fishing is one of the most thrilling fishing experiences you can have in East Lake. You can experience Tarpon fishing by hiring one of the local guides. They will show you all the productive spots and fishing methods.
Tarpon prefer to reside in shallows, bays, flats, and rivers. Crabs, pinfish, and mullet would be the ideal bait.
Note: You won’t be able to land your catch because Tarpon is a catch-and-release-only fishery. You can’t lift Tarpon out of the water if its length is over 40 inches. So be delicate with your catch, take a memorable photo, and let it go.

Most trips are all-inclusive. Captains provide everything you need for a fishing trip: tackle, rods, reels, bait, and a cooler with ice. Usually, Captains clean anything that you catch.
Captains provide a saltwater fishing license. This license covers all the anglers on the vessel.
A Fishing charter has to have a federal permit if you are planning to fish in the federal waters.
Depending on the weather, Captains recommend bringing sunscreen, polarized sunglasses, long sleeve shirt, hat, windbreaker, waterproof jacket, waterproof pans, appropriate non-skid footwear, gloves, your medicines, bug bite cream, sanitizer, drinks, and snacks.
Bring your freshwater license if you are planning to fish in the freshwater.
Some Captains don’t recommend bringing spray sunscreen, liquor, weapons, fireworks, and inappropriate footwear.
